    Unhappy How to get totals from 2 workbooks

    I want to get the total number of each widget Component associated with each document over the past 9-10 months or by quarter

    Notes:
    The same Component can be used in multiple documents
    Multiple Components per document
    Each widget Component has its own part number
    Each Document has its own part number


    This is the nformation I have from 2 workbooks:

    Wkbk 1
    1. The Part Number of each Component associated with each document
    2. The Quantity of each Component used with each document
    3. Document part number

    Wkbk 2
    1. Document part number, date, month & quarter/FYyy.
    A. Ex: Date = 2/21/2013 - Month = FEB 13 - Quarter = Q3 FY13
    2. Multiple rows & columns of the same document part number

    The following examples are from Wkbk 2
    Example of Column Headers
    Doc1 Doc2 Doc3 Qty of Widgets per Doc Date Month Quarter

    Example of a Rows
    1234 abcd -- 6 2/19/2013 FEB 13 Q2 FY13
    abcd 7890 wxyz 10 4/2/2013 APR 13 Q3 FY13
    wxyz 1234 abcd 2 6/1/2013 JUN 13 Q3 FY13

    Confused? Me too. I am a little familiar with Pivot Tables but not enough to configure this for my answer. Any help would be appreciated. I have struggled for a couple of days.
